Transaction f8ca23f32fab9cfbd8c88c109a24de2a3d6fcea976ca7548a009f67923a92f42

77 Input
2 Outputs
  • f8ca23f32fab9cfbd8c88c109a24de2a3d6fcea976ca7548a009f67923a92f42:0
  • value  400000000
    address  3EL3FGs6zosVe3d2WJkT7MTJ6jzfAcxozU
  • f8ca23f32fab9cfbd8c88c109a24de2a3d6fcea976ca7548a009f67923a92f42:1
  • value  22940275
    address  34SRC2gnSrwo6c6WbCzvnVfbzgqtXdwjja